In a piece of code I haven’t worked on in a while, I’m suddenly getting a new 
warning which I’ve never seen before:

“Multiple unsequenced modifications to ‘ix’”

Code is:


ix = ++ix % guess.count;

where ix is a NSUInteger.

Is this telling me that the order of the preincrement and the mod operation is 
undefined? Surely a preincrement is defined to happen first, that’s why it’s 
called a PREincrement? Or does the warning refer to something else? I’ve used 
this form of expression for years without any issues, why is it suddenly one?
